Arrhythmia Surgery

Arrhythmia surgery is a medical procedure aimed at correcting abnormal heart rhythms, known as arrhythmias, which can lead to serious health issues. During the surgery, doctors may use various techniques, such as catheter ablation, to destroy small areas of heart tissue causing the irregular heartbeat. In some cases, surgeons might implant devices like pacemakers to help regulate the heart's rhythm. The goal of the surgery is to restore a normal heartbeat, improve heart function, and reduce symptoms, enhancing overall quality of life for the patient. It is typically considered after other treatments have not been effective.
